520 Grape St, Hammonton, NJ 08037 is a 2 bedroom, 1 bathroom, 1,240 sqft single-family home built in 1954. This property is not currently available for sale. 520 Grape St was last sold on Dec 13, 2019 for $170,000. The current Trulia Estimate for 520 Grape St is $315,500.
